From 8243a86961d3c1e06a8bcbb16186eb710ef2b044 Mon Sep 17 00:00:00 2001 From: wonderinghost Date: Wed, 20 Nov 2024 02:25:36 -0500 Subject: [PATCH] hmm --- code/modules/mob/living/silicon/robot/robot.dm | 4 +++- code/modules/mob/living/silicon/robot/robot_modules.dm | 1 - 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/code/modules/mob/living/silicon/robot/robot.dm b/code/modules/mob/living/silicon/robot/robot.dm index 29aae5a309f0..22eb8767ac4d 100644 --- a/code/modules/mob/living/silicon/robot/robot.dm +++ b/code/modules/mob/living/silicon/robot/robot.dm @@ -12,6 +12,8 @@ blocks_emissive = EMISSIVE_BLOCK_UNIQUE light_system = MOVABLE_LIGHT_DIRECTIONAL light_on = FALSE + + radio = new /obj/item/radio/borg var/custom_name = "" var/braintype = "Cyborg" @@ -142,7 +144,7 @@ update_law_history() //yogs - radio = new /obj/item/radio/borg(src) + if(!scrambledcodes && !builtInCamera) builtInCamera = new (src) builtInCamera.c_tag = real_name diff --git a/code/modules/mob/living/silicon/robot/robot_modules.dm b/code/modules/mob/living/silicon/robot/robot_modules.dm index ec1a786cb6bd..d314d3f43d79 100644 --- a/code/modules/mob/living/silicon/robot/robot_modules.dm +++ b/code/modules/mob/living/silicon/robot/robot_modules.dm @@ -228,7 +228,6 @@ R.module = RM R.update_module_innate() RM.rebuild_modules() - R.radio.recalculateChannels() var/datum/component/armor_plate/C = R.GetComponent(/datum/component/armor_plate) if(C) // Remove armor plating. C.dropplates()